IV.5.1.2 Micro-scale strain analysis<br />

IV.5.1.2.1 Qualitative analysis<br />

Relevant areas were selected from the large SEM pictures of the deformed microgrids, and the dis-<br />

placements of the grid intersections (with reference to their undeformed configurations) were used to<br />

calculate the distribution of the local strain components and of the equivalent strain using the proce-<br />

dure <strong>des</strong>cribed in section IV.4.3. The calculated data were used to plot colour maps for different levels<br />

of strain. The corresponding microstructures, in their undeformed configuration, were edited to extract<br />

the interphase boundaries. The boundaries were then superimposed to the colour map in order to<br />

reveal clearly the link with the microstructure.<br />

It has been chosen to plot the strain maps using the undeformed configuration because it was easier<br />

to extract the interphase boundaries from the initial microstructure compared to the deformed micro-<br />

structure. Indeed, in the deformed configuration it is very difficult to see the interphase boundaries due<br />

to a slight oxidation, or in some areas large distortion of the microgrids.<br />

The equivalent strain maps of the two microstructures D1_W and D2_W are respectively shown in<br />

Figure IV.23 and Figure IV.24. In each plane strain compression specimen, two different regions are<br />

analyzed, hence two strain maps are plotted (map1 and map2).<br />
